The History of Popcorn
Popcorn has a rich history that dates back thousands of years. Archaeologists have found popcorn remnants in ancient Mexican ruins, indicating that it was a staple food for early civilizations. The process of popping corn involves heating kernels until the moisture inside turns to steam, causing the kernel to explode and form the fluffy popcorn we enjoy today. Over time, popcorn has evolved from a simple snack to a cultural icon, especially in the context of movie theaters.

Types of Popcorn
Popcorn comes in various types, each offering a unique texture and flavor. Understanding the different types can help you choose the best one for your movie night.
| Type of Popcorn | Characteristics |
|---|---|
| Mushroom Popcorn | Small, dense kernels that pop into a compact shape, ideal for coating with caramel or cheese. |
| Butterfly Popcorn | Large, fluffy kernels that pop into a light, airy shape, perfect for traditional movie theater-style popcorn. |
| Snowflake Popcorn | Medium-sized kernels that pop into a delicate, fluffy shape, often used for garnishing desserts. |
Health Benefits of Popcorn
While popcorn is often associated with indulgence, it also offers several health benefits. When prepared correctly, popcorn can be a nutritious snack. Here are some of the health benefits:
- High in Fiber: Popcorn is a whole grain and is high in fiber, which aids in digestion and helps you feel full.
- Low in Calories: Air-popped popcorn is low in calories, making it a great snack for those watching their weight.
- Rich in Antioxidants: Popcorn contains polyphenols, which are antioxidants that can help protect against chronic diseases.
- Gluten-Free: Popcorn is naturally gluten-free, making it a suitable snack for those with gluten sensitivities.
🍿 Note: To maximize the health benefits, avoid adding excessive butter, salt, or sugar. Opt for air-popping or using a small amount of healthy oil.
Making the Perfect Large Bag of Popcorn at Home
Creating the perfect large bag of popcorn at home can be a fun and rewarding experience. Here are some steps to help you achieve movie theater-quality popcorn:
- Choose the Right Popcorn: Select high-quality popcorn kernels that are fresh and free from moisture.
- Use the Right Equipment: A popcorn maker or a large pot with a lid can be used. For a healthier option, consider an air popper.
- Heat the Oil: If using oil, heat it to the right temperature before adding the kernels. This ensures even popping.
- Add the Kernels: Add the kernels to the hot oil or air popper and cover. Shake the pot gently to ensure even heating.
- Season to Taste: Once the popcorn is popped, season it with your favorite toppings. Salt, butter, and spices like garlic powder or paprika can enhance the flavor.

Popcorn Around the World
Popcorn is enjoyed globally, with each culture adding its unique twist. Here are some international popcorn variations:
- Mexico: Popcorn is often seasoned with chili powder and lime juice for a spicy, tangy flavor.
- Japan: Sweet popcorn flavors like matcha or strawberry are popular.
- India: Popcorn is often seasoned with spices like turmeric, cumin, and coriander.
- United States: Classic buttered popcorn remains a favorite, but gourmet flavors like truffle or kale are gaining popularity.
